TODO: replace it to GFDL-1.1-or-later WITH no-invariant-sections - -.. _V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_FRAME_SIZE: - -*********************************** -ioctl V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_FRAME_SIZE -*********************************** - -Name -==== - -V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_FRAME_SIZE - Enumerate media bus frame sizes - - -Synopsis -======== - -.. c:function:: int ioctl( int fd, V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_FRAME_SIZE, struct v4l2_subdev_frame_size_enum * argp ) - :name: V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_FRAME_SIZE - - -Arguments -========= - -``fd`` - File descriptor returned by :ref:`open() <func-open>`. - -``argp`` - Pointer to struct :c:type:`v4l2_subdev_frame_size_enum`. - - -Description -=========== - -This ioctl allows applications to enumerate all frame sizes supported by -a sub-device on the given pad for the given media bus format. Supported -formats can be retrieved with the -:ref:`V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_MBUS_CODE` -ioctl. - -To enumerate frame sizes applications initialize the ``pad``, ``which`` -, ``code`` and ``index`` fields of the struct -:c:type:`v4l2_subdev_mbus_code_enum` and -call the :ref:`V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_FRAME_SIZE` ioctl with a pointer to the -structure. Drivers fill the minimum and maximum frame sizes or return an -EINVAL error code if one of the input parameters is invalid. - -Sub-devices that only support discrete frame sizes (such as most -sensors) will return one or more frame sizes with identical minimum and -maximum values. - -Not all possible sizes in given [minimum, maximum] ranges need to be -supported. For instance, a scaler that uses a fixed-point scaling ratio -might not be able to produce every frame size between the minimum and -maximum values. Applications must use the -:ref:`VIDIOC_SUBDEV_S_FMT <VIDIOC_SUBDEV_G_FMT>` ioctl to try the -sub-device for an exact supported frame size. - -Available frame sizes may depend on the current 'try' formats at other -pads of the sub-device, as well as on the current active links and the -current values of V4L2 controls. See -:ref:`VIDIOC_SUBDEV_G_FMT` for more -information about try formats. - - -.. c:type:: v4l2_subdev_frame_size_enum - -.. tabularcolumns:: |p{4.4cm}|p{4.4cm}|p{8.7cm}| - -.. flat-table:: struct v4l2_subdev_frame_size_enum - :header-rows: 0 - :stub-columns: 0 - :widths: 1 1 2 - - * - __u32 - - ``index`` - - Number of the format in the enumeration, set by the application. - * - __u32 - - ``pad`` - - Pad number as reported by the media controller API. - * - __u32 - - ``code`` - - The media bus format code, as defined in - :ref:`v4l2-mbus-format`. - * - __u32 - - ``min_width`` - - Minimum frame width, in pixels. - * - __u32 - - ``max_width`` - - Maximum frame width, in pixels. - * - __u32 - - ``min_height`` - - Minimum frame height, in pixels. - * - __u32 - - ``max_height`` - - Maximum frame height, in pixels. - * - __u32 - - ``which`` - - Frame sizes to be enumerated, from enum - :ref:`v4l2_subdev_format_whence <v4l2-subdev-format-whence>`. - * - __u32 - - ``reserved``\ [8] - - Reserved for future extensions. Applications and drivers must set - the array to zero. - - -Return Value -============ - -On success 0 is returned, on error -1 and the ``errno`` variable is set -appropriately. The generic error codes are described at the -:ref:`Generic Error Codes <gen-errors>` chapter. - -EINVAL - The struct - :c:type:`v4l2_subdev_frame_size_enum` - ``pad`` references a non-existing pad, the ``code`` is invalid for - the given pad or the ``index`` field is out of bounds. |
